Give and take

A linocut that echoes the powerful words of a radical Naepolitan doctor (made a saint after his death), St Giuseppe Moscati, who while alive looked after the poor and destitute, and had a notice up in his office which read “Those who can, please give. Those who can not, please take.” A simple idea that resources are enough for all, if only we learn to circulate them properly and with great generosity. These words have been popping up in the city of Naples during the COVID-19 crisis, with people sharing the little they have with those who have even less.
